From b48a1540b73a3c3a9ef59ce34176cc8180c6ce57 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?UTF-8?q?Asbj=C3=B8rn=20Sloth=20T=C3=B8nnesen?= Date: Sun, 9 Jun 2024 17:33:51 +0000 Subject: [PATCH 1/5] flow_offload: add encapsulation control flag helpers M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it This patch adds two new helper functions: flow_rule_is_supp_enc_control_flags() flow_rule_has_enc_control_flags() They are intended to be used for validating encapsulation control flags, and compliment the similar helpers without "enc_" in the name. The only difference is that they have their own error message, to make it obvious if an unsupported flag error is related to FLOW_DISSECTOR_KEY_CONTROL or FLOW_DISSECTOR_KEY_ENC_CONTROL. flow_rule_has_enc_control_flags() is for drivers supporting FLOW_DISSECTOR_KEY_ENC_CONTROL, but not supporting any encapsulation control flags. (Currently all 4 drivers fits this category) flow_rule_is_supp_enc_control_flags() is currently only used for the above helper, but should also be used by drivers once they implement at least one encapsulation control flag. There is AFAICT currently no need for an "enc_" variant of flow_rule_match_has_control_flags(), as all drivers currently supporting FLOW_DISSECTOR_KEY_ENC_CONTROL, are already calling flow_rule_match_enc_control() directly. Only compile tested.
